Hazard Reminder Check

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2004 Nissan Frontier.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. CHECK HAZARD INDICATOR 

    Check if hazard indicator flashes with hazard switch.

    Does hazard indicator operate? 

    1. Yes: GO TO 2.
    2. No: Check "hazard indicator" circuit. Refer to TROUBLE DIAGNOSES .
  2. CHECK KEYFOB OPERATION 

    Check door lock/unlock operation with keyfob.

    Does door lock/unlock operate? 

    1. Yes: GO TO 3.
    2. No: Check keyfob battery. Refer to KEYFOB BATTERY CHECK  .
  3. CHECK HAZARD REMINDER OUTPUT SIGNAL 

    Measure voltage between smart entrance control unit connector M111 terminals 47 (G/Y) and 48 (G/R), and ground with CONSULT-II or voltmeter when hazard reminder is operated.

    Fig 1: Checking Voltage Between Smart Entrance Control Unit Connector M111 Terminals 47 (G/Y) And 48 (G/R), And Ground
    G00848398Courtesy of NISSAN MOTOR CO., U.S.A.

    OK or NG 

    1. OK: Check harness for open or short between smart entrance control unit and turn signal lamps.
    2. NG: Replace smart entrance control unit.
